A bit of history

The first successful attempts at highlighting appeared back in 1960. The innovator of this technology was the still little-known French hairdresser Jacques Dessange. This is not the only discovery of a hairdresser in the fashion world: the famous women's garcon haircut, experiments with perming hair - all this came out thanks to the talented hands of Dessange. Today, thousands of beauty salons are open all over the world under his name.

And for more than 5 decades, highlighting has remained one of the most common methods of hair coloring., which in the usual case would mean the imminent extinction of the popularity of this dyeing technology.

However, this technique survived all adversity and sparkled with bright colors with the opening of a new fashion season.

Advantages and disadvantages

Girls with streaked curls can be found literally every day - on TV, in fashion magazines, and just the street is full of fashionistas who appreciated this technique. Let's take a look at the main positive reasons why highlighting is still at the peak of its relevance.

  • Modern methods of hair dyeing allow you not to risk hair health. Already today, there are gentle paints and brighteners that only slightly lighten the hair - within 30-40%, thanks to which you simultaneously get the desired appearance of the hair without causing severe harm to it.
  • High-quality highlighting stays on the hair for a long time (3-4 months) - for girls with long hair, this effect lasts longer. If the type of highlighting is chosen without affecting the hair roots, this effect can persist for six months or more, in contrast to the usual coloring, which must be carried out regularly to maintain the saturation of the hair.
  • The highlighting technique is great for any hairstyle, type, color and length of hair. The same applies to age restrictions, which this technique is not burdened with.
  • Highlighting is one of the cheapest hair coloring techniques. As a rule, only two shades are involved in the procedure - third-party and natural, therefore, neither the master nor the fashionista herself needs to buy a large amount of expensive coloring agents.
  • One of the main advantages of highlighting is the creation of natural volume through the "effect of sun-bleached hair." Thanks to the smooth color transitions, the hair looks voluminous, shiny, and most importantly - healthy.
  • The XXI century offers a huge number of varieties of highlighting - even the most sophisticated fashionista can find something, really, to her liking.
  • Highlighting will not be difficult to do at home, it is a long, but quite feasible procedure for every beauty.

Highlights have their own minuses, which, even in spite of the rapid passage of time and the development of more and more new and perfect hair coloring techniques, survived from the second half of the 20th century.

  • Any coloring, even partial, as is the case in the case of highlighting, causes some harm to the hair. Highlighted hair without proper care can quickly weaken, lose density and healthy appearance. Usually, such problems appear after using low-quality paints or due to brute force with the duration of wrapping.
  • It is not recommended to highlight recently colored hair or hair that has been permed. In this case, there is a greater risk of getting a completely unexpected result - due to conflicts in the composition of different paints.
  • Girls with already weakened and damaged hair should also refrain from momentary highlights. After this procedure, the hair will weaken even more. We advise you to heal and restore your natural curls first, and then experiment with color.
  • Highlighting on hair dyed with natural dyes is especially undesirable. Lightening the curls will have to be done in several stages (which, again, is another stress for the curls), since natural dyes, such as henna, are very poorly lightened.

On dark and black hair

The current season is pretty sparse for dark hair experiments. Any luxurious dark hairstyle is designed to sparkle in the center of attention, while dark curls are offered modest naturalness and spontaneity this season.

At the moment, there are several dyeing techniques in trend for dark hair.

  • Venetian highlights - selective lightening of strands in the head of hair, starting from the ends of the hair. Used shades: caramel, wheat tones, honey and nut shades.
  • Classic highlighting - the best option that will never go out of style. Looks equally good with any texture and hair length.
  • Armor technique - slight highlighting by dyeing certain strands in soft chocolate and chestnut tones.
  • Veil technique or lightening hair ends with the further use of styling products for styling. Renews the hairstyle, gives a natural shine.

For redheads

Despite its unique natural beauty, all red-haired girls suffer from one problem - over time, such hair quickly loses its saturation and brightness, dims and loses volume. Highlighting is the perfect way out of the situation.The right shades will not only give the hairstyle the same depth, but also decorate them with unique solar tints and new bright tones.

Present to your attention popular techniques for highlighting red hair in the current season.

  • Selective and zonal staining thin red curls in pastel colors with nutty, honey and wheat shades.
  • Highlighting with light tones: golden, sunny, platinum shades. The option is suitable for warm color types such as summer and autumn - with light or dark / creamy skin.
  • Dark highlights - ideal for girls of autumn color type (dark eyes, light skin). For red-haired girls with this color type, rich chocolate and coffee shades are great.
  • Scarlet staining. Red color in red hair will only add saturation and shine to the entire hairstyle. Strawberry, wine, crimson shades can fit perfectly here, depending on the color of your natural hair.

Sparing

Light classic type. Unlike other types of highlighting, this type causes the minimum amount of damage to the curls and changes the natural hair color to a minimum. In this case, the masters use the minimum range of shades, and the coloring is based on ammonia-free coloring solutions. To this type, you can also add partial highlighting of hair - up to medium length, only bangs or only the ends of curls.

Ombre

Ombre in the modern sense is a technique of highlighting curls, in which smooth color transitions of shades on the hair are observed. It can be both natural shades that are most similar to each other, and cardinally contrasting ones. The technique usually uses 2 or 3 basic shades, the effect of uniformity is achieved by gradual shading.

This technique looks most effective on long curly curls.

California

The staining method itself was named after one of the American states. It was in hot California that girls from prolonged exposure to the sun received the famous effect of burnt hair, which gives the curls a visual volume and attractive sun glare and play.

As a result, there is a whole variety of coloring, for which there is no need to go to California and bask for many hours in the hot American sun - coloring of this kind is included in the list of mandatory techniques for any experienced stylist.

The current fashion season, as we have already said, encourages any natural hairstyle, and therefore unpretentious but stylish Californian highlighting has every chance of breaking out into the leading positions of successful and relevant hairstyles. The plus of such highlighting in uniform smooth transitions from the hair roots to the very ends, where the roots remain unchanged, and the tips are 2-3 tones lighter or darker.

The most successful tones for Californian highlights are selected based on the color of your natural hair and the color of your eyes. Increasingly, there is a clear prevalence of gentle, soft pastel shades in hairstyles: honey, golden, soft chestnut, wheat tones.

American

The American type of highlighting, like the Venetian, was originally developed for women and girls with dark and black curls. It was intended to give them a little more natural volume by supplying the hair with light gradient overflows.

If in the Venetian and California highlighting a maximum of 2-3 shades were used, then in this case the masters could experiment with 3-4 tones to give the hair the coveted glossy effect. This effect is achieved by applying dye or clarifier only to the front of the hair, without affecting the lower layer.

The advantage of this method is that the natural color of the curls is completely preserved, and the colored ends with the help of styling products are laid in such a way as to give the hairstyle more dynamics and even a kind of sloppy look.

New for the season is the trend towards American highlights with soft caramel and chestnut shades on dark or even black curls. This effect looks most successful with long, slightly curly curls.

Venetian

The peculiarity of Venetian highlighting is in the extremely selective lightening of individual thin strands of hair. This creates an overall slight sun discoloration effect. The technique itself came to us from Italian fashionistas at the end of the 20th century. Fashionistas specially spent whole hours under the Italian sun in order to achieve at least minimal light reflections on the hair. Italy is a country of dark-haired and dark-skinned women, and therefore the sun glare on such curls was especially appreciated.

If before the current season it was fashionable to use bright and sometimes even contrasting shades in this type of highlighting, then today, the preference is given to all the same naturalness. The difference between the tones of bleached and natural hair should be literally minimal, and thin curls, which were previously distributed throughout the head of hair in complete disarray, now fit in close proximity to each other.

If we consider the differences between the Californian and Venetian highlighting styles, then the first type was initially aimed at fair-haired ladies who wanted to give their hairstyle more depth and naturalness, while the second was intended for dark hair and served to refresh them and update the entire image of the girl.

The upcoming season offers Venetian highlighting a palette of shades from red cognac in dark hair, ripe pear and caramel shades in light curls.
